What are the methods of roof inspection?


Roof inspections are important for identifying potential points and making certain the longevity of your roof. Go here may help detect problems early, stopping expensive repairs or replacements down the line. Here are some widespread strategies and steps for conducting a roof inspection:

Visual Inspection:

a. Exterior Inspection:

Start by analyzing the roof from the ground utilizing binoculars or by safely climbing onto a ladder to get a more in-depth look.
Look for seen indicators of damage, similar to lacking or damaged shingles, curling or buckling shingles, or unfastened or deteriorated flashing around roof penetrations.
Check for debris, moss, algae, or lichen progress on the roof, which may indicate moisture-related points.
Inspect the gutters and downspouts for granules from shingles, as excessive granule loss can sign shingle put on.
b. Interior Inspection:

Go into the attic or crawl house and inspect the underside of the roof deck for indicators of leaks, moisture, or water stains.
Look for daylight coming through cracks or holes within the roof deck, which can point out roof damage.
Check for signs of insulation harm, mould, or mildew growth, which can outcome from roof leaks.
Roof Walk:

a. If it is secure to do so, stroll on the roof surface to inspect it up close.
b. Be cautious and wear applicable safety gear, such as non-slip shoes and a safety harness if wanted.
c. Look for any gentle or spongy areas, which may indicate underlying injury.
d. Check for loose or broken roofing supplies, as well as indicators of wear and tear.

Moisture Detection:

a. Use a moisture meter to detect hidden moisture within the roof structure and insulation.
b. Moisture detection might help determine leaks or areas of potential water intrusion that is most likely not seen.
